Excelsior Correspondent
JAMMU, Feb 28: Under the patronage of Justice Arun Palli, Chief Justice, High Court of Jammu & Kashmir and Ladakh (Patron-in-Chief, J&K Judicial Academy), guidance of Chairperson and Members of Governing Committee, the Jammu & Kashmir Judicial Academy today organized a one day integrated workshop on “Court Management, Mediation and Legal, Social & Psychological Dimensions of Dowry-Related Offences” for Judicial Officers of Jammu Province.
The programme commenced with registration, followed by an introduction and welcome address by Naseer Ahmad Dar, Director, J&K Judicial Academy, who underscored the importance of judicial leadership, effective court administration and sensitivity while dealing with socially complex offences.
Session-I on Judicial Leadership & Court Management was delivered by Pawan Dev Kotwal, Former District & Sessions JudgeK. The session focused on the role of a judge as an institutional leader, court and case management principles, control of docket flow, time management techniques, and best practices including the use of technology to enhance efficiency in the justice delivery system.
Session-II on Role of Judges in Mediation & Drafting of Referral/Settlement Orders was conducted by M S Parihar, former District & Sessions Judge. He elaborated on the statutory framework under Section 89 CPC and relevant rules, identification of cases fit for mediation, stage and manner of referral, components and ethics of mediation, drafting of effective referral and settlement orders, and practical challenges faced in mediation proceedings.
Session III addressed the Legal, Social and Psychological Dimensions of Dowry-Related Crimes, in light of the recent Supreme Court Judgment dated 15.12.2025 in State of UP Versus Ajmal Beg & Others. The session was conducted by Kamlesh Pandita, former District & Sessions Judge along with Sumedha Sharma, Clinical Psychologist Associate.
The workshop witnessed active participation and interaction from the Judicial Officers, followed by a feedback session.
